Bird’s 25 Watt Convection-Cooled RF Attenuators provide reliable signal reduction for RF professionals working with higher-power systems. Designed for use in test environments, system protection, and signal isolation, these attenuators feature robust construction, passive self-cooling, and full shielding to prevent unwanted radiation.
With conservative power ratings and broadband capability, the 25 W Series helps maintain measurement integrity and component safety—without the need for external power or active cooling.

25‑A Series
Convection-cooled and fully shielded for dependable attenuation in mid-band RF systems—no AC power or active cooling needed.
25‑6A Series
Compact, self-cooled attenuation up to 6 GHz—ideal for reducing power, isolating components, and ensuring accurate, repeatable RF measurements.
25‑18A Series
Ideal for broadband and high-frequency applications, with rugged, passive design and reliable performance up to 18 GHz.
